Transaction 17aee3dfdb93fba2d1150893902b4f6cf062d9201a70abf20eb6e17d3f429982
1 Input
1 Output
-
17aee3dfdb93fba2d1150893902b4f6cf062d9201a70abf20eb6e17d3f429982:0
- value
- 56828542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34912994ede84921c8c275e014f902eecd2e9d57 OP_EQUAL
- address
- 36Uxxafm8Gc8fDkqkaqRvK4rWnj8YibtN1